/// Run the full-text search and materialize the matching rows as Arrow batches,
/// ordered best-score-first with a `__paimon_search_score` column appended (the
/// internal `_PKEY_VECTOR_POSITION` column is never exposed).
///
/// Only the primary-key full-text path can materialize rows: it produces
/// physical `(data file, row position)` hits that a subsequent read turns into
/// table rows. Dispatch mirrors Java `primaryKeyFullTextDefinition` — the PK
/// path is taken only when data-evolution is DISABLED and the queried column is
/// a configured `pk-full-text.index.columns` entry. The PK full-text read is
/// FAST-mode only; `FULL`/`DETAIL` fail loud (no silent degrade). A query that
/// does not resolve to the PK path also fails loud rather than silently
/// returning nothing, since the append/data-evolution materialized read is not
/// supported here.
pub async fn execute_read(&self) -> crate::Result<ArrowRecordBatchStream> {
// Fail closed: returns data outside `TableScan`/`TableRead`.
let core = CoreOptions::new(self.table.schema().options());
core.ensure_read_authorized()?;
let text_column =
self.text_column
.as_deref()
.ok_or_else(|| crate::Error::ConfigInvalid {
message: "Text column must be set via with_text_column()".to_string(),
})?;
let query_text = self
.query_text
.as_deref()
.ok_or_else(|| crate::Error::ConfigInvalid {
message: "Query text must be set via with_query_text()".to_string(),
})?;
let limit = self.limit.ok_or_else(|| crate::Error::ConfigInvalid {
message: "Limit must be set via with_limit()".to_string(),
})?;

if !resolves_to_pk_full_text_path(&core, text_column) {
return Err(crate::Error::Unsupported {
message: "materialized full-text read (execute_read) is only supported on the \
primary-key full-text path (data-evolution disabled and the column \
configured in pk-full-text.index.columns)"
.to_string(),
});
}

// FAST-only: reject FULL/DETAIL loud rather than silently degrading.
if core.global_index_search_mode()? != GlobalIndexSearchMode::Fast {
return Err(crate::Error::DataInvalid {
message: "primary-key full-text search supports only the FAST global-index search \
mode"
.to_string(),
source: None,
});
}

// Reject a non-positive limit at construction, before the empty-plan fast
// path — an empty table must not mask an invalid limit (mirrors Java
// `PrimaryKeyFullTextRead`, and matches `search_bucket`'s own guard).
if limit == 0 {
return Err(crate::Error::ConfigInvalid {
message: "Limit must be positive".to_string(),
});
}

// Resolve the queried column's schema field id for the scan/field-id guard.
let field_id = find_field_id_by_name(self.table.schema().fields(), text_column)
.ok_or_else(|| crate::Error::DataInvalid {
message: format!("full-text search column '{text_column}' does not exist"),
source: None,
})?;

let plan = PrimaryKeyFullTextScan::new(self.table, field_id, None)
.plan()
.await?;
if plan.splits.is_empty() {
return Ok(Box::pin(stream::empty()));
}

// A predicate-free materialization reader projecting the user table
// columns (mirrors `table_read.rs::new_data_file_reader` with an empty
// predicate list). The PK read appends the score column itself.
let materialize_reader = DataFileReader::new(
self.table.file_io().clone(),
self.table.schema_manager().clone(),
self.table.schema().id(),
self.table.schema().fields().to_vec(),
self.table.schema().fields().to_vec(),
Vec::new(),
);
let read = PrimaryKeyFullTextRead::new(
self.table.file_io().clone(),
materialize_reader,
self.table.location().trim_end_matches('/').to_string(),
);
read.read(&plan, query_text, limit).await
}
}

/// Whether a query on `text_column` resolves to the primary-key full-text read
/// path. Mirrors Java `primaryKeyFullTextDefinition`: taken only when
/// data-evolution is DISABLED and the column is a configured
/// `pk-full-text.index.columns` entry (membership via the non-erroring accessor so
/// a malformed config cannot abort an unrelated append/DE query).
fn resolves_to_pk_full_text_path(core: &CoreOptions<'_>, text_column: &str) -> bool {
!core.data_evolution_enabled()
&& core
.primary_key_full_text_index_columns()
.iter()
.any(|c| c == text_column)
}
